Functional Conflict
Disagreements that contribute positively to organizational outcomes by enhancing work processes or performance.
Groupthink
A psychological phenomenon that occurs within a group of people, in which the desire for harmony or conformity results in an irrational or dysfunctional decision-making outcome.
Administrative Orbiting
A tactic used to delay decision-making through endless reviews and requests for additional information without outright refusal.
Distributive Bargaining
A negotiation strategy that focuses on dividing a limited amount of resources between parties where one party's gain is the other's loss.
